全国旗舰校区

不同学习城市 同样授课品质

北京

深圳

上海

广州

郑州

大连

武汉

成都

西安

杭州

青岛

重庆

长沙

哈尔滨

南京

太原

沈阳

合肥

贵阳

济南

下一个校区
就在你家门口
+
当前位置:首页  >  技术干货

java静态代码块存储在哪里

发布时间:2023-08-25 02:12:17
发布人:xqq

Java静态代码块存储在类的字节码文件中,具体来说是存储在类的静态区域。

静态代码块是在类加载的过程中执行的一段代码,它在类的静态成员(静态变量和静态方法)初始化之前执行。静态代码块使用static关键字来修饰,并使用花括号包裹代码块。

静态代码块的主要作用是在类加载时进行一些初始化操作,例如初始化静态变量、加载静态资源等。它可以用来执行一些只需执行一次的操作,例如读取配置文件、初始化数据库连接等。

静态代码块的执行顺序是在类加载的过程中按照代码的顺序执行的。当类被加载时,静态代码块会被执行一次,且只会执行一次。如果一个类中定义了多个静态代码块,它们会按照定义的顺序依次执行。

需要注意的是,静态代码块不能被显式地调用,它会在类加载的时候自动执行。静态代码块中只能访问静态成员变量和静态方法,不能访问非静态成员变量和非静态方法。

总结一下,Java静态代码块存储在类的字节码文件中的静态区域,它在类加载的过程中执行一次,用于进行一些初始化操作。

#java静态代码块什么时候执行

相关文章

抖音小店怎么上货赚钱快呢

2023-09-22

关于抖音小店商品上架流程表述不正确的是

2023-09-22

抖音小店直播平台佣金是多少钱

2023-09-22

抖音小店运营规则调研数据分析怎么写

2023-09-22

抖音小店做什么比较好

2023-09-22

抖音团长号出租可靠吗

2023-09-22
在线咨询 免费试学 教程领取